// LOYALTY_LEDGER_SETTLEMENT_WINDOW_HOURS
//
// Governs how long the Pemberfox loyalty-points ledger holds
// pending accruals before settlement. We lowered this from 48
// to 24 after the Duskwright promo caused double-credits when
// reversals landed inside the old window. Do not raise it
// without coordinating with the reconciliation team, since the
// nightly sweep assumes settlement completes before midnight.
// Any change must be re-validated against the replay harness.
// The token for the last validated build appears below.

pipeline stamp: htk3_100

Dispatch desk,

The weekly tape rotation for the Norwick data room runs Thursday as usual. Crate BT-22 holds fourteen LTO cartridges, logged and sealed by the Fennor Systems night operator. The crate must travel in the climate-controlled compartment — last month's run in the open bay triggered a humidity alert on arrival at the Caldmere vault. Please book the same vehicle class as last rotation and confirm the pickup window with the vault attendant in advance. The courier hand-over instruction is appended below this message.

courier memo of yawep-yafog: the pramir ulaix courier leaves the ulavan aldix frair zorok oliiel joreth rusdor fenvan ledger at gate 1305 under passcode 514738

Subject: DR Drill Notes — Pooler Failover (Marlowe Cluster)

Team,

During Thursday's disaster-recovery drill we validated that the Quillstack connection pooler fails over cleanly to the standby in the Marlowe cluster. Pool saturation stayed under 60% throughout. One gap: the standby's admin socket requires manual unlocking after failover, and this step isn't automated yet. Future maintainers, when prompted during the unlock step, enter the passphrase below.

unlock words, hahip-yagef: zorok-novmir-zorix-silax

# KeyTurn rotation utility — plugin-facing constants.
# Plugins must not rotate secrets more often than the floor below;
# violations are rejected, not queued. Grace windows let old
# credentials drain before revocation. Values are enforced
# server-side, so overriding them locally has no effect.
# The enforced constants are listed below.

tuning table, yajog-yahof:
BUDGETS = {
    "lamvan": 303,
    "wenox": 460,
    "fenvan": 525,
}